Job Description
The Manufacturing Associate II works in a cleanroom production environment to assemble, inspect, and package continuous glucose monitoring systems. This role focuses on highly repetitive, hands-on work on a fast-paced production line, ensuring products meet quality standards and are accurately documented in electronic systems.
Responsibilities
Work in a cleanroom environment within the transmitter department on a high-volume production line.
Assemble and build continuous glucose monitoring systems, including G6 Pro transmitters and related components.
Manually move product pieces one by one down the line as part of a very manual assembly process.
Manually pair and attach applicators to transmitter components according to standard operating procedures.
Inspect products at each stage of the process for defects and ensure only quality parts move forward.
Package finished products for shipment to hospitals, following all packaging and labeling requirements.
Learn and perform each portion of the production line to provide flexibility and coverage across operations.
Perform electronic line clearances and accurately enter production and quality data into the Camstar application.
Maintain the required pace of the production line while performing repetitive tasks with consistency and accuracy.
Follow all SOP, GMP, and GDP requirements to ensure compliance with quality and regulatory standards.
Adhere to all cleanroom protocols, including gowning procedures, PPE use, and contamination control.
Demonstrate reliable attendance and punctuality to support continuous production operations.

Work Environment
This position is based in a cleanroom manufacturing environment on a production line. You will wear a full cleanroom suit provided by the employer, including mask, goggles, gloves, hair net, shoe covers, full bunny suit, and head cover. The production floor is temperature controlled and kept cold to support product quality. The environment is loud, and side chatter is discouraged to maintain focus and safety. Work is extremely fast paced and highly repetitive, with employees working in close proximity to one another on the line. No makeup, jewelry, piercings, fake nails, or nail polish are allowed on the manufacturing floor to comply with cleanroom and contamination-control standards. Overtime is not mandatory but is preferred, typically occurring up to two hours before the regular shift.
